| 27th May 2006 | Fraud Investigation | Time Warner, Ernst to Settle Fraud Suit |
| Report |
| Time Warner Inc., its AOL subsidiary and auditor Ernst & Young have agreed to pay $23 million to settle a lawsuit accusing them of defrauding a Pennsylvania pension fund for teachers and state workers. The suit, filed in February 2004, claimed that the companies overstated revenue and subscriber figures after the merger of New York-based Time Warner and America Online Inc., based in Dulles, Va., was announced in 2000, Pennsylvania Atty. Gen. Tom Corbett said. The Pennsylvania case was among a group of suits filed by more than 100 pension funds and other investors. |
